Later, you will be going for a tour around Kathmandu Durbar Square enlisted as one of the eight World Heritage sites by UNESCO. Kathmandu Durbar Square, is a cluster of ancient temples like Kumari Chowk; the Courtyard of the living Goddess “Kumari”, Aakash Bhairav Temple, Temple of Lord Machhindranath, palace courtyards and streets that date back to the 12th and 18th centuries.

You will walk through Itumbahal, an old Newari settlement set in a large courtyard and famous for its traders in herbal spices and medicines. From here you continue to Indrachowk, one of Kathmandu’s most colorful and ancient local markets and Ason chowk; another market dedicated to spices and local vegetables, and Annapurna temple, which is dedicated to the goddess of Grains. Sightseeing of Swayambhunath Stupa – on top of a conical hill, reached by climbing a few steps, where a panoramic view of Kathmandu city can be witnessed. The Buddhist pilgrimage center –  Swayambhunath Stupa, situated on the top of a hill, west of Kathmandu, is one of the most popular, holy, and instantly recognizable symbols of Nepal. The temple is colloquially known as the ‘monkey temple because of the large tribe of roving monkeys who guard the temple.

Pashupatinath Temple, dedicated to the Hindu Lord – Shiva, the God of Destruction, also known as Pashupatinath (Lord of Animals) is, moreover, one of the final destinations for Hindu devotees of all around the world. Built in around 400 A.D, the temple is located by the holy river Bagmati, decorated within the perfection of ancient arts and crafts. Four of the main gates of the temple are made of silver. Each gate is allocated for the four-faced lingam (phallic symbol of Shiva), which is to express that the blessing of the lord shall spread in all four directions around the world.

Many Hindu Sadhus from all around the world are spotted around preference of the temple, with long dreadlocks, meditating by the bank of the Bagmati river, and occasionally smoking marijuana, seen impersonating Lord Shiva.

Later, you will embark on a captivating sightseeing tour in Bhaktapur Durbar Square, exploring historical architecture and heritage, made up of three large squares filled with many shrines and temples. Bhaktapur is the essential Newari city with some of the finest architecture in Nepal. In its heyday (14th-16th centuries) Bhaktapur was the most powerful of the Kathmandu Valley kingdoms and its capital for 300 years.

Despite earthquakes and frequent rebuilding, Bhaktapur today retains a medieval feel; its neighborhoods are still caste-oriented and centered around the old ponds or tanks (built to store water for drinking, washing and religious ceremonies) and which continue as a social focal point. Local people here are predominantly farmers or engaged in the traditional crafts of pottery, metalwork, art and woodwork which have supported the city since its establishment in the 12th century to service the trade route between Tibet and India and remain active industries. Pharping is a small Newar town lying above the Bagmati River on the southern edge of the Kathmandu valley. It is also an important site for Buddhist pilgrimage and monasteries. Pharping boasts extraordinary, panoramic views. From the top of the hill, the view of the Himalayas and the Kathmandu Valley is simply breathtaking.
